what controlls adds?
who or what controlls what addvertisements are shown on the site,
and is there a way to keep it politic free? |

We pre-sell advertising and then use 3rd party services to fill our remaining ad inventory. For these 3rd party services, we specifically block anything political or not intended for a general ages audience. There are settings we can use to specifically block them, and we pretty much block all of the filterable categories.
That being said, once in a while an ad can fall through the filter if someone administrating these services doesn't flag the ad properly. That's probably what happened if you saw a political ad. If it's coming up repeatedly for you, please screencap it and send me a link to the image via PM. We can find the ad in the appropriate system and report it for not being flagged properly. |
